@rvv0643 жыл бұрын
Hi mate, which server are you playing on? The game has many versions and servers, the more populated ones can split the match making better, the smaller servers sometimes end up mixing high and low level more often than desired (although tbh it is not that common in the servers I play at least). Also you'll want to figure out which troops are one shotting one, is it cavalry or muskets, or something else? Then learn to counter and avoid them accordingly. For example any cavalry is highly countered by imperial pikes, a purple troop which you can get relatively early if you focus your progression towards them.
